Conhecimento Etnoecológico Na Pesca Artesanal Do Camarão Marinho (Penaeidae): Sinergia Dos Saberes.

Abstract: <p>A pesca no Brasil apresenta significativa importância por ser exercida por muitas comunidades ao longo da costa e por ser uma atividade fornecedora de alimento e renda. Além destas, possui uma grande variedade de técnicas e diversidade no manejo das espécies capturadas. Uma das técnicas de pesca mais utilizadas na costa nordestina é a do arrastão de praia, sendo tradicionalmente direcionada para a captura dos camarões. “…Due to its economic and social importance, aspects of X. kroyeri shrimp have been studied, such as its population structure, reproduction, ecology, and genetics (See Table I). On the other hand, studies on the species related to LEK of fishers are still scarce in the country, as well in area of distribution of this species (Musiello-Fernandes et al 2017, Nascimento et al 2018). Thus, shrimp trawling management considers only the biological aspects of the resource available in the literature, despite the evident importance of studies related to LEK for success in fisheries management (Foster & Vincent 2010).…”
